Abstract

The distinctive columnals of myelodactylid crinoids from the Upper Llandovery of Gotland show a wide range of morphologies. This indicates that myelodactylids were more diverse during the Silurian than is indicated by the fossil record of more complete specimens. Although unattached, myelodactylids were not free-swimming (as has previously been suggested), a conclusion supported by comparison with modern crinoids, gross myelodactylid morphology and an SEM study of columnal microstructure. Rather, genera such as Myelodactylus and Herpetocrinus probably lay on the unconsolidated sediment surface with the coiled stem and cirri enclosing the crown.
